Sled dog races on track in Greenville Feb. 2
Greenville is going to the dogs on Saturday, Feb. 2 -- sled dogs that is. It’s an exciting time of year to be here – watching enthusiastic dogs and their mushers pulling sleds through the snowy, wooded trails around Greenville in the Wilderness Sled Dog Race. Amy Dugan and John Osmond of Shirley began this event more than a dozen years ago. This is the eleventh time this event has occurred – there were a few years in between where conditions were prohibitive and the race was not held.

Nominations sought for 2020 Teacher of the Year
As part of the Maine Department of Education’s ongoing efforts to highlight Maine’s outstanding teachers, nominations are now open for the 2019 County Teachers of the Year and 2020 Teacher of the Year. Members of the public are encouraged to nominate educators who demonstrate a commitment to excellence and nurturing the achievement of all students. Nominations can be made through the Maine Teacher of the Year website through Feb. 4.
